After you brew tea it has a shelf life of about 8 hours at normal room temperature. You need to refrigerate tea after 8 hours if you want it to still be good. Unbrewed tea, however, does not need to be refrigerated and is best stored in a cool dry place. You could also freeze tea bags or leaves, but it is not ideal. For hot-brewed tea, it is recommended that you don’t keep your tea in the fridge more than 8 hours. If … Webb18 apr. 2024 · Tea absorbs odors very easily. This trait allows for the creation of amazing scented teas, such as Jasmine Pearls, but it also means that storing your tea near a spice cabinet, trashcan or another aromatic area is a no-no.
